1701 S Ridgewood Ave Edgewater, FL 32132
Get Directions 0.0 miles
**Contact store for hours of operation
1701 S Ridgewood Ave Edgewater, FL 32132
Get Directions 0.0 miles
1445 S Dixie Fwy New Smyrna Beach, FL 32168
Get Directions 2.6 miles
1698 State Rd 44 New Smyrna Beach, FL 32168
Get Directions 3.9 miles